Output 3945540978456091dc7f71989ea59c60d40cd6cbacb05e22e146a4d5ad8efa64:5

value
32102728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ad24c13245c0d4b028c887a91f5e544a677dc72 OP_EQUAL
address
MWmP66EniDUpTBC6h1ZrJWxpsjtXsdfHbU
transaction
3945540978456091dc7f71989ea59c60d40cd6cbacb05e22e146a4d5ad8efa64
spent
true